Let your kid write a blog for an activity. Writing is a wonderful way to teach your curriculum and writing a blog is a great way to get in the writing your child use their imagination. Let you kid pick the subject that he is passionate about. Set up an account with a blogging website and be sure that it will be private. This allows them the skill of creating a factual essays online that requires previous research and stimulates needed literary skills. They could also write a short story about topics that others may find enjoyable.
